Title: Red Tails

Tagline: High-Octane Action and Daring Dogfights!

Genre: Drama, Action, Adventure, History, War

Director: Anthony Hemingway

Cast: Bryan Cranston, David Oyelowo, Cuba Gooding Jr., Daniela Ruah, Terrence Howard, Andre Royo, Robert Kazinsky, Lee Tergesen, Matthew Leitch, Michael B. Jordan, Method Man, Gerald McRaney, Matthew Marsh, Barnaby Kay, Chris Riedell, Leslie Odom Jr., Nate Parker, Marcus T. Paulk, Kevin Phillips, Paul Fox, Lars van Riesen, David Gyasi, Josh Dallas, Okezie Morro, Aml Ameen, Nathaniel Martello-White, Anthony Welsh, Rick Otto, Rupert Penry-Jones, Ryan Early, Brian Gross, Ciarán McMenamin, Matthew Alan, Michael Dixon, Paul Hampshire, Leon Ockenden, Dan Hirst, Mark Doerr, Richard Conti, Philip Bulcock, Dave Power, Sam Daly, Justin Irving, Tina D'Marco, Jaime King, Sam Kennard, Tristan Mack Wilds, Ne-Yo

Release: 2012-01-19

Runtime: 125

Plot: The story of the Tuskegee Airmen, the first African-American pilots to fly in a combat squadron during World War II.

There's an interview with McCallum in the new Star Wars Insider where he talks briefly about it.

Here's the info:

-They have a writer currently working on the script (as AICN said)
-They hope to have a first draft complete by Christmas.
-They're not sure if it's a summer movie or a winter movie.
-If the script is what they want, they'll start in March or April and if it's not, they'll hopefully start in the fall 2008.
-They've scouted locations in Italy, Croatia, Tunisia, and Hungary.
-Lucas isn't direcing and they'll choose a director when they finish the script.
-ILM is going to work on it (surprise :) ).
-The story isn't about racism or the fight to setup the Tuskegee Airmen, it's an adventure story about what happened once they were serving in the military.
